Choosing an Experienced Car Accident Lawyer
The aftermath of a car accident can be overwhelming for the victims. They are often faced with severe injuries and costly property damage.
A good attorney can aid them in recovering the amount they are due. They will ensure that responsible parties are properly identified and held accountable for their actions.
Experience
An experienced car accident lawyer can assist you in getting the compensation you are entitled to for your injuries and the damages. They can handle the complex legal process and ensure all deadlines are met. They can also deal with insurance companies and take them to court when necessary. This allows you to concentrate more on recovery and return to your normal life sooner.
A lawyer can also help you determine the extent of your losses, which includes future and past medical bills as well as lost wages as well as property damage and pain and suffering. It can be difficult to calculate the totality of your losses on your own. An attorney's knowledge and experience can make a significant difference in how much money you get.
When choosing a law firm, select one with a proven track record of success as well as a good name. You can also read reviews on the internet and ask friends and family members to recommend a company. Next, schedule a consultation with the lawyer to evaluate the lawyer's qualifications and availability. Find out about their payment plan and fee structure.
Selecting a New York car accident lawyer with the appropriate experience can be crucial for your case. The experience and qualifications of a lawyer could influence the outcome of your case. It is therefore crucial to choose a firm that has experience in handling similar cases to yours.
Before they can be admitted to bar and licensed attorneys must complete many years of law school and pass rigorous tests. In addition, they must keep their education up to date to keep up with changes in statutory and case law. They have a deeper understanding of the law that applies to your particular case.
An experienced attorney will have a wealth of experience dealing with insurance companies. This can be difficult to negotiate an equitable settlement. They know how to assess the extent of your injuries, calculate your financial losses, and they may even have access to expert witnesses who can assist in proving your case. Additionally they will not be hesitant to challenge insurance companies in court when required and can get you the maximum compensation for your claim.

Fees
The cost of hiring a car accident lawyer can be a major obstacle for many accident victims. However, the services of a seasoned legal professional is often worth the cost. They can assist you in navigating the many complexities of an injury claim and increase your odds of obtaining a greater settlement or court award, as well as make sure that all damages are fully compensated. They can also offer advice and assurance during a difficult period.
It is essential to take into account the lawyer's expertise as well as their reputation and communication skills. Also, think about their fee structure. It is crucial to select an attorney who is familiar with the laws of your state and how insurance companies operate in car accidents. A good car accident lawyer should be able to explain complicated legal concepts in a manner that is easy for the client to comprehend and respond to any queries promptly.
A car accident lawyer typically charges a contingent fee. This means that they will take a portion of the amount you receive. This is the standard procedure in the majority of states. However, some lawyers may charge an hourly or a flat fee instead of a contingency fee. It is best to discuss fees with potential attorneys during the initial consultation.
It is also crucial to be aware of any other costs that may be incurred in the course of the case. These costs can include court filing fees as well as other expenses including medical experts or investigators. A good car accident lawyer will be able to explain these costs to you and obtain your approval prior to committing any extra costs.
